- the present invention relates to the field of images and networks, and in particular, to a method and system for recognizing a person in a video network conference.
- Video refers to various technologies that capture, record, process, store, transmit, and reproduce a series of still images as electrical signals.
- continuous image changes exceed 24 frames per second, the human eye cannot distinguish a single static image according to the principle of visual persistence; it looks like a smooth continuous visual effect, so that the continuous picture is called video.
- Video technology was first developed for television systems, but has now evolved into a variety of formats for consumers to record video. The development of network technology has also caused video recording segments to exist on the Internet in the form of streaming media and can be received and played by computers. Video and film belong to different technologies, and the latter uses photography to capture dynamic images as a series of still photos.

- FIG. 1 is a diagram of a character recognition method for a video network conference according to a first preferred embodiment of the present invention. The method is as shown in FIG.
- Step S101 configuring avatar information of the participant
- Step S102 When receiving the voice information, acquire an image of the location corresponding to the voice information, and identify the image to determine whether it is a participant;
- Step S103 If the participant is a participant, the voice information is played.
- the technical solution provided by the present invention configures the avatar information of the participant, and when receiving the voice information, acquires an image of the location corresponding to the voice information, and identifies the image to determine whether it is a participant, and if the participant is a player, the player Voice information, so it has the advantage of high security.
- the foregoing method may further include:
- the image information is sent to the conference organizer for review, and if the audit is passed, the voice information is played.
- the foregoing method may further include:
- the name and position of the participant are displayed on the image.
- FIG. 2 is a character recognition system for a video network conference according to a second preferred embodiment of the present invention.
- the system includes:
- the configuration unit 201 is configured to configure avatar information of the participant
- the identifying unit 202 is configured to: when receiving the voice information, acquire an image of the location corresponding to the voice information, and identify the image to determine whether the participant is a participant;
- the playing unit 203 is configured to play the voice information if it is a participant.
- the technical solution provided by the present invention configures the avatar information of the participant, and when receiving the voice information, acquires an image of the location corresponding to the voice information, and identifies the image to determine whether it is a participant, and if the participant is a player, the player Voice information, so it has the advantage of high security.
- the above system may further include:
- the auditing unit 204 is configured to send the image information to the conference organizer for review if the participant is not a participant, and if the audit is passed, play the voice information.
- the above system may further include:
- the display unit 205 is configured to display the name and position of the participant on the image.

Abstract
L'invention concerne un procédé de reconnaissance de silhouette pour une vidéoconférence de réseau. Le procédé consiste : à configurer des informations de portrait de tête d'un participant ; lors de la réception d'informations vocales, à obtenir une image de la position correspondant aux informations vocales, et reconnaître l'image pour déterminer si la personne qui parle est le participant ; et si tel est le cas, à lire les informations vocales. L'invention améliore la sécurité de conférence.
